Business Description
Hampton Roads Bankshares Incorporation. The Group's principal activity is to provide general community and commercial banking services. It serves as a holding company for Bank of Hampton Roads and operates through 18 offices located in Chesapeake, Suffolk, Norfolk and Virginia Beach, Virginia. It accepts deposits and lends deposits on profitable terms to individuals and small to medium sized businesses. The deposits are in the form of both demand and time accounts including checking accounts, interest checking, money market accounts, savings accounts, certificates of deposit and IRA accounts. The loans consist of secured or unsecured loans including loans to individuals and businesses for personal, household, family purposes, working capital, plant expansion and equipment purchases. It operates only in United States.
